"""medio types for type annotations
Author: Jacob Reinhold <jcreinhold@gmail.com>
"""
from __future__ import annotations
__all__ = [
"Bounds",
"DataAffine",
"Direction",
"PathLike",
"Shape",
"ShapeLike",
"SupportsArray",
"TripletFloat",
]
import collections.abc
import os
import typing
import numpy as np
import numpy.typing as npt
DType = typing.TypeVar("DType", bound=np.generic, covariant=True)
T = typing.TypeVar("T", bound=npt.NBitBase)
Float = typing.Union[np.floating[T], float]
Int = typing.Union[np.integer[T], int]
# https://www.python.org/dev/peps/pep-0519/#provide-specific-type-hinting-support
Bound = tuple[Float[T], Float[T]]
Bounds = tuple[Bound[T], Bound[T], Bound[T]]
DataAffine = tuple[npt.NDArray[DType], npt.NDArray[np.float64]]
Direction2D = tuple[Float[T], Float[T], Float[T], Float[T]]
Direction3D = tuple[Float[T], Float[T], Float[T], Float[T], Float[T], Float[T]]
Direction = typing.Union[Direction2D[T], Direction3D[T]]
PathLike = typing.Union[str, os.PathLike]
Shape = tuple[Int[T], ...]
ShapeLike = typing.Union[
typing.SupportsIndex, collections.abc.Sequence[typing.SupportsIndex]
]
TripletFloat = tuple[Float[T], Float[T], Float[T]]
